Shirley Hazzard

    30. leden 1931 – 12. prosinec 2016

    Shirley Hazzardová byla autorkou elegantní a precizní prózy, jejíž díla často zkoumala složitost mezilidských vztahů a lidské povahy. Její stylistická vytříbenost a cit pro detail dominovaly jejím románům i nebeletristickým pracím. Ačkoliv její životní zkušenosti zahrnovaly cestování po světě a práci pro mezinárodní organizace, její psaní se soustředilo na hluboké literární zkoumání a ostrou kritiku politických a společenských institucí. Hazzardová mistrně zachycovala vnitřní život svých postav a zároveň je zasazovala do širšího kontextu globálních událostí.

      The Great Fire is Shirley Hazzard's first novel since The Transit of Venus, which won the National Book Critics Circle Award in 1981. The conflagration of her title is the Second World War. In war-torn Asia and stricken Europe, men and women, still young but veterans of harsh experience, must reinvent their lives and expectations, and learn, from their past, to dream again. Some will fulfill their destinies, others will falter. At the centre of the story, a brave and brilliant soldier finds that survival and worldly achievement are not enough. His counterpart, a young girl living in Occupied Japan and tending her dying brother, falls in love, and in the process discovers herself. In the looming shadow of world enmities resumed, and of Asia's coming centrality in world affairs, a man and a woman seek to recover self-reliance, balance, and tenderness, struggling to reclaim their humanity.

      Long out of print, Shirley Hazzard's classic novel of love and memory A young Englishwoman working in Naples, Jenny comes to Italy fleeing a history that threatened to undo her. Alone in the fabulously ruined city, she idly follows up a letter of introduction from an acquaintance and so changes her life forever. Through the letter, she meets Giocanda, a beautiful and gifted writer, and Gianni, a famous Roman film director and Giocanda's lover. At work she encounters Justin, a Scotsman whose inscrutability Jenny finds mysteriously attractive. As she becomes increasingly involved in the lives of these three, she discovers that the past--and the patterns of a lifetime--are not easily discarded.
